Transformative higher education environments for the next generation of healthcare professionals 

We pride ourselves on taking the time to understand each project on its own terms, from the specific ambitions of its institution to the character of its place and the needs of the people it will serve. The Emily Siddon Building at the University of Huddersfield exemplifies this approach, bringing together higher education, healthcare training and community facilities in a single, future focused learning environment.  

Delivered in partnership with Calderdale and Huddersfield NHS Foundation Trust, it supports hands-on clinical training for healthcare professionals alongside vital diagnostic services for the local community. Flexible, future ready spaces allow it to evolve with changing needs, with wellbeing, sustainability and patient experience woven into every design decision.

Designed for the future, today 

At Woodmill and St Columba’s RC High School every aspect of this project was carefully considered, from Fife Council’s ambition to achieve Passivhaus standards to an interior design approach that draws on the natural tones of Dunfermline and the surrounding Pentland Hills. The school brings two communities together within a single, cohesive environment, where a fabric-first sustainable design approach underpins both energy efficiency and design quality. 

Now the world’s largest Passivhaus-certified education building, it sets a new benchmark for energy performance, comfort and long term resilience. Light filled teaching facilities and shared social spaces support enriched learning and a strong sense of community, while also providing a valuable local resource. The result is a future-ready school environment that benefits pupils, staff and the wider community alike.

Collaborative approach, human-focused outcome 

At Pear Tree SEND School, our approach was rooted in collaboration from day one, working closely with the Trust, families and young people to shape a school built around their real needs. Designed for up to 133 pupils aged 11 to 19 with complex learning needs, it has been carefully planned to feel safe, intuitive and welcoming, with spaces that empower staff and enable every young person to feel confident and supported.

This project builds on our wider commitment to inclusive education design, as seen at Silverwood SEND School, a 350-place, net zero carbon school environment designed for a broad spectrum of needs. At Pear Tree, that same ethos is expressed through a calm, legible layout and thoughtfully designed spaces that benefit not only pupils and staff, but also the wider community. Together, these projects demonstrate our belief that well designed educational environments can make a meaningful difference to people’s lives.

Passivhaus is a performance standard focused on reducing energy demand while improving comfort and air quality. For schools, it creates stable, healthy environments that support learning while significantly lowering energy use and running costs.
